Greensboro, NC
The Pride drove across town to face the Quakers of Guilford College for an afternoon game today (March 1), and came away with a 20-15 win. Greensboro jumped all over Guilford, scoring nine runs in the first frame.Â
Adam Weber started the game with a single to right field, then advanced to third on a fielding error.Â
Josh Pittman followed with an RBI double, and would then score on back-to-back wild pitches. Guilford struggled throwing strikes, as they also walked two hitters, hit one batter, and advanced all runners on a balk, all in the first inning. Up 7-0, Pittman hit a 2-RBI single on his second time to the plate of the inning, increasing Greensboro's margin to 9-0.
The Pride scored another in the 3rd inning as
Braxton Rupp hit an RBI single, scoring
Adam Weber. Then in the 5th inning,
Branden McMillian drove in Alex Morales on an RBI double down the left field line.
Guilford would not go away quietly, as they answered Greensboro's hot start with four runs in the first inning, and three runs in the fourth inning to claw back into the game.
Alex Morales' 2-RBI single in the 6th inning increased Greensboro's lead to 13-8, but Guilford would tie the game after five runs on five hits in the sixth inning. The Quakers got good production from Bryce Vestral, who went 4-6 with 2 RBI for the game.
Greensboro answered again in the 7th as
Cam Watts drilled a single through the left side of the infield to score two runners.Â
Braxton Rupp put the game out of reach with a 3-RBI double to left that made the score 19-13 after 7 innings. The Pride would hold on to win 20-15.
Greensboro's Alex Morales and
Braxton Rupp did the heavy lifting for the Pride, with Morales going 3 for 4 and, and
Braxton Rupp going 4 for 7 with three doubles and five RBI from the plate.
Greensboro improves to 3-1 on the season, and will return to the diamond as they travel to Mount Berry, GA this weekend to face Denison University, Adrian College, and Berry College in the Berry College Tournament.
